
BMW X1xDrive 20i M Sport 5dr Step Auto
2020
46,268 miles
Petrol
£21,180
15 miles away
£21,180
£9,920
£19,110
£13,530
£25,790
£1,220 off£14,460
£21,691
£14,840
£17,768
£45,750
£950 off£40,060
£18,570
£22,300
£2,490 off£16,750
£460 off£14,610
£600 off£17,680
£12,380
£13,350
235-252 of 722 vehicles